网络工程师视角,为什么你连不上VPN?常见原因与解决方案全解析

hyde1011 15 2026-03-13 23:15:48

作为一名网络工程师,我经常接到用户的问题:“我连不上VPN,怎么办?”这个问题看似简单,实则涉及网络协议、防火墙策略、设备配置、甚至地理位置等多个层面,我就从专业角度出发,为你详细梳理“无法连接VPN”的常见原因,并提供可操作的解决方案。

我们要明确什么是VPN,虚拟私人网络(Virtual Private Network)是一种通过公共网络(如互联网)建立加密隧道的技术,用于远程访问企业内网或绕过地理限制,常见的VPN协议包括OpenVPN、IPSec、L2TP、WireGuard等,当用户无法连接时,问题往往出在以下几个环节:

  1. 网络连通性问题
    最基础的检查是确认你当前的网络是否通畅,如果你连不上互联网,自然也无法连接到VPN服务器,建议使用ping命令测试目标地址(如ping 8.8.8.8),如果失败,请先排查本地网络,比如重启路由器、更换DNS(如使用1.1.1.1或8.8.8.8)、检查是否被ISP限速或封禁。

  2. 防火墙或安全软件拦截
    很多企业级防火墙(如华为、思科、Fortinet)或个人防火墙(如Windows Defender、卡巴斯基)会默认阻止非标准端口的流量,VPN常用端口如UDP 1194(OpenVPN)、TCP 443(某些代理型VPN)可能被屏蔽,解决方法:联系IT部门开放相应端口;或者尝试切换协议(例如从UDP改用TCP)。

  3. DNS污染或域名解析失败
    如果你使用的是域名形式的VPN服务器(如vpn.example.com),而本地DNS无法正确解析该域名,就会导致连接失败,你可以尝试手动设置DNS服务器,或使用dig命令验证域名解析结果,某些地区还会出现DNS污染(即返回错误IP),此时推荐使用Cloudflare的1.1.1.1作为首选DNS。

  4. 认证失败或证书过期
    若你使用的是企业或商业VPN服务,身份验证通常依赖用户名/密码或数字证书,若密码错误、证书过期(尤其在OpenVPN中),连接将直接被拒绝,建议检查登录信息是否正确,或重新下载最新配置文件(如.ovpn文件),有些公司还要求双因素认证(2FA),请确保已启用。

  5. ISP限制或政府监管
    在一些国家或地区,ISP可能主动阻断VPN流量(尤其是未经许可的加密隧道),这是最棘手的情况,因为普通用户无法更改运营商策略,此时可尝试使用混淆技术(obfuscation)的VPN客户端,或选择支持“伪装流量”功能的服务(如WireGuard + TLS伪装)。

  6. 设备兼容性问题
    某些老旧设备(如安卓4.x以下系统、不支持TLS 1.3的路由器)可能无法兼容现代VPN协议,建议升级操作系统或固件,或更换支持更广泛协议的硬件。

强烈建议使用专业的网络诊断工具,如Wireshark抓包分析数据流,或使用traceroute查看路径中是否有丢包节点,这些工具能帮你精准定位问题所在。

“不能连VPN”不是单一故障,而是多层网络问题的集合,作为网络工程师,我的经验是:先查基础连通性,再逐层深入——防火墙、DNS、认证、ISP、设备,每一步都可能藏着“罪魁祸首”,掌握这些排查逻辑,你就能快速恢复连接,不再被“连不上VPN”困扰。

网络工程师视角,为什么你连不上VPN?常见原因与解决方案全解析

上一篇:德国HVPN,企业网络优化与安全连接的利器
下一篇:不用VPN上外网?教你安全合规地访问国际网络资源
相关文章
返回顶部小火箭